South Korea Watt Meter Market Overview

The South Korea watt meter market is experiencing robust growth, driven by increasing industrial automation, rising energy efficiency standards, and a strong push towards digital transformation. As of 2023, the market size is estimated to be valued at approximately USD 150 million, with projections indicating a compound annual growth rate (CAGR) of around 8.5% over the forecast period (2023–2030). This growth is fueled by technological advancements in measurement devices, expanding applications across manufacturing, utilities, and building management sectors, and a rising emphasis on sustainable energy consumption. The increasing adoption of smart grid technologies and the integration of IoT-enabled measurement solutions further bolster market expansion, positioning South Korea as a key player in the regional watt meter landscape.
